Overview

TL7705BQDRG4 from Texas Instruments is a precision supply-voltage supervisor IC designed as a reset controller for microprocessor and microcontroller systems. It monitors the SENSE input for undervoltage conditions, provides true and complement reset outputs (RESET and RESET), features an externally adjustable reset pulse duration via CT capacitor, and operates across –40°C to 125°C with a 4.55 V nominal threshold voltage. It is used in automotive-grade embedded control modules requiring high-temperature reliability.

Technical Context

The TL7705BQDRG4 implements a precision bandgap-based voltage reference and comparator architecture to detect supply drops at the SENSE pin. Its internal timing circuit uses a current source charging an external CT capacitor to generate a user-defined reset pulse width (td ≈ 2.6 × 10⁴ × CT).

It supports three functional modes: automatic reset on undervoltage, manual reset override via RESIN, and power-on reset activation below 1 V VCC. The REF output provides a stable 2.53 V reference for external use, and both RESET outputs are open-collector, requiring external pull-up/pull-down resistors.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Supply Voltage Range3.6 V to 18 V - supports wide-input industrial and automotive rails without external regulation
Threshold Voltage (VIT−)4.55 V (typ), ±50 mV - precise detection of 5 V system supply faults
Hysteresis30 mV - prevents chatter during slow-rising/falling supply transitions
Operating Temperature–40°C to 125°C - qualified for under-hood and high-reliability industrial environments
Reset OutputsOpen-collector RESET (active-high) and RESET (active-low) - enables flexible interface with diverse logic families
Reference Output2.53 V (typ), ±50 mV - stable, temperature-compensated voltage source for external circuitry
Timing ControlCT pin with external capacitor - allows programmable reset pulse width (e.g., 0.1 µF → ~2.6 ms)

Pinout & Package

TL7705BQDRG4 is housed in an 8-pin SOIC (D) package, 4.90 mm × 3.91 mm body size, RoHS-compliant with NiPdAu lead finish and Level-1 MSL rating.

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
1 (REF)Output2.53 V precision reference voltage; requires 0.1 µF bypass capacitor to suppress noise-induced false triggering
2 (RESIN)InputActive-low manual reset override; forces RESET high and RESET low when asserted
3 (CT)InputTiming capacitor connection; sets reset pulse duration (td ≈ 2.6 × 10⁴ × CT)
4 (GND)PowerAnalog and digital ground reference; must be low-impedance connection to minimize noise coupling
5 (RESET)OutputActive-low open-collector reset signal; requires external pull-up resistor for proper logic-level assertion
6 (RESET)OutputActive-high open-collector reset signal; requires external pull-down resistor to avoid floating state
7 (SENSE)InputUndervoltage monitoring node; compares against internal 4.55 V threshold to trigger reset
8 (VCC)PowerPrimary supply input; powers internal circuitry and defines operating range (3.6–18 V)

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
Externally adjustable reset pulse durationEnables precise tailoring of reset hold time (e.g., 100 µs to >100 ms) using standard capacitor values
True and complement reset outputsEliminates need for external inverters in systems requiring both active-high and active-low reset signals
RESET output defined down to VCC ≥ 1 VEnsures reliable power-on reset initiation even during brown-out or slow-ramp startup conditions
Temperature-compensated voltage referenceMaintains ±50 mV threshold accuracy over full –40°C to 125°C range without external calibration
Automatic reset after voltage dropGuarantees system recovery only after supply stabilizes above VIT+, preventing premature release

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ar voltage supervisor applications.

Alternative PartTechnical DifferenceApplication DifferenceSelection Advice
TPS3808G33DBVRFixed 3.3 V threshold; internal timing (no CT pin); 1.8–6 V supply rangeLacks adjustable reset duration and dual complementary outputs; optimized for low-voltage portable systemsSelect when fixed 3.3 V supervision suffices and board space limits external capacitor placement
MAX6326UT46D3+T4.63 V threshold; push-pull outputs; 1.0–5.5 V supply; no REF outputHigher threshold tolerance (±1.5%) but no reference voltage source; limited temperature range (–40°C to 85°C)Choose for tighter threshold accuracy where REF functionality is unnecessary and ambient temperature stays ≤85°C

Compared with TPS3808G33DBVR and MAX6326UT46D3+T, the TL7705BQDRG4 uniquely combines Q-grade temperature operation, dual complementary open-collector outputs, adjustable timing, and a buffered reference output-making it optimal for high-reliability industrial and automotive reset control where flexibility and extended environmental robustness are required.

FAQ

What is the operating temperature range specified for the TL7705BQDRG4?

The TL7705BQDRG4 is characterized for operation from –40°C to 125°C, as indicated by the "Q" suffix in its part number. This qualifies it for under-hood automotive applications and high-temperature industrial environments where standard commercial or industrial grade supervisors would fail. The datasheet confirms this range applies specifically to the TL7705BQ variant, not the BC or BI versions.

How does the CT pin function in the TL7705BQDRG4?

The CT pin on the TL7705BQDRG4 connects to an external capacitor that sets the reset pulse duration. An internal current source charges the capacitor until it reaches a threshold, determining the time delay before RESET and RESET deactivate after a supply recovery. The relationship is td ≈ 2.6 × 10⁴ × CT, so a 0.1 µF capacitor yields ~2.6 ms. TL7705BQDRG4 requires this capacitor for proper reset timing behavior.

Why does the TL7705BQDRG4 provide both RESET and RESET outputs?

The TL7705BQDRG4 provides complementary open-collector outputs (RESET active-high, RESET active-low) to directly interface with diverse logic families without external inversion. This eliminates the need for additional gate logic in systems requiring simultaneous assertion of both polarities-for example, resetting an FPGA (active-low) while enabling a watchdog timer (active-high). Both outputs are synchronized and share identical timing characteristics.

What is the purpose of the REF pin on the TL7705BQDRG4?

The REF pin on the TL7705BQDRG4 delivers a precision 2.53 V (typ), temperature-compensated reference voltage with ±50 mV tolerance over –40°C to 125°C. It is intended for use as a stable voltage source in external circuits-such as ADC references, comparator thresholds, or sensor biasing-reducing system BOM count and improving overall voltage monitoring accuracy. A 0.1 µF capacitor to GND is mandatory for noise immunity.

Can the TL7705BQDRG4 be used to monitor voltages other than 5 V?

Yes, the TL7705BQDRG4 can supervise any supply between 3.6 V and 18 V by scaling the SENSE input with an external resistor divider. Its 4.55 V threshold is fixed, so for non-5 V rails (e.g., 12 V or 3.3 V), a divider sets the voltage at SENSE to 4.55 V when the monitored rail reaches the desired trip point. The TL7705BQDRG4's wide supply range and precision reference support accurate scaled supervision across multiple rail voltages.
